Abstract

With a critical view on heidegger's interpretations, plato's late ontology is reconstructed and summarized under the headings of "being," "copula," "idea," "appearance," "ground," "truth," "unforgottenness," "in no time," "the good," "the demoniac hyperbole," "self," and "time and being."
